Webthe boondocks noun [ plural ] US disapproving uk / ˈbuːn.dɒks/ us / ˈbuːn.dɑːks/ any area in the country that is quiet, has few people living in it, and is a long way away from a town … WebJun 12, 2024 · Boondocks is American slang that was coined in the early 1940s. The word comes from the Tagalog word bundók, which literally means “mountain,” and is used as shorthand to refer to the rural, mountainous areas of the country.

WebIn a very distant or remote location, often one that lacks modern amenities. "Boondocks" comes from the Tagalog word bundok, meaning "mountain," and originated as US military slang. That place is all the way out in the boondocks—it'll take us hours to get there. Good luck getting a cell signal out here in the boondocks.
